titleOfInvention | Preparation method of erlotinib hydrochloride |
abstract | The invention relates to a preparation method of erlotinib hydrochloride, which comprises the following steps: reacting 2-amino-4, 5-dimethoxybenzoic acid with formamide to generate a compound 5, and reacting the compound 5 with 3-ethynylaniline to generate a compound 3 after bromination reaction; the compound 3 reacts with 48% hydrobromic acid under the action of a catalyst to obtain a compound 2, and then the compound and iodoethyl methyl ether generate erlotinib hydrochloride under the action of alkali and the catalyst. The method has the advantages of mild conditions, low impurity content, safety, no pollution, environmental protection and suitability for industrial production. |
